Output 83f87a28b75edc1cfa72373a360e66c461c1c3bef6f95ab843812c39246d35d8:0

value
385860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aacd3ca82450f0f53586af9156c004d564bb62dd OP_EQUAL
address
MPUGy9tHHBaKsHbqruiVHCp8m3A6woMNpr
transaction
83f87a28b75edc1cfa72373a360e66c461c1c3bef6f95ab843812c39246d35d8
spent
true